Prime location across from the legendary Fox Theatre.
Rooftop pool offers a 360-degree view of the city.
National Reg. of Historic Places status makes for an intriguing backstory (if also the occasional dated appliance).
With floor-to-ceiling windows, crystal chandeliers and marble columns, this place has the right to call itself grand.
